Sevenoaks News, 30th August 1972
Knockers had a few uneasy moments in their five-wicket win over Battle on Sunday. The visitors batted first, and despite defiance by Powell and Price were brought to 125 for 9 by effective catching and bowling.
After losing an early wicket, Knockers batsmen Ellison, Golds, Miller and Sims scored steadily to bring up a winning total, but five wickets fell before the victory was achieved.
